summaryrefslogtreecommitdiff
path: root/lib/tapicero/user_database.rb
diff options
context:
space:
mode:
authorjessib <jessib@riseup.net>2013-11-18 11:16:47 -0800
committerjessib <jessib@riseup.net>2013-11-18 11:16:47 -0800
commit058d861119a5dc3afbc0f763985355998f443972 (patch)
tree573fe03b8683238c37d2b459578fd27d15e51129 /lib/tapicero/user_database.rb
parent7b2b5472ffc306fff2cdd49cf8415a035093eb5d (diff)
parent8e1f23521eac0586ec13bdf502bd37a09f53a4a0 (diff)
Merge pull request #2 from azul/feature/delete-user-databases
Delete per user databases if the user has been deleted
Diffstat (limited to 'lib/tapicero/user_database.rb')
-rw-r--r--lib/tapicero/user_database.rb5
1 files changed, 5 insertions, 0 deletions
diff --git a/lib/tapicero/user_database.rb b/lib/tapicero/user_database.rb
index 84ed300..ec2694a 100644
--- a/lib/tapicero/user_database.rb
+++ b/lib/tapicero/user_database.rb
@@ -24,6 +24,11 @@ module Tapicero
CouchRest.put security_url, security
end
+ def destroy
+ db = CouchRest.new(host).database(name)
+ db.delete! if db
+ end
+
protected
def secured?